Hon. Kojo Asemanyi Pledges to Elevate Gomoa East to Municipal Status

Former Member of Parliament and NPP parlimentary candidate for Gomoa East, Hon. Kojo Asemanyi, has vowed to upgrade the district to a municipal assembly within three months if re-elected. Asemanyi made this promise during the “Kojo Oku 4 Kojo” program, emphasizing the need for a competent MP to drive development.
Asemanyi, a member of the New Patriotic Party, previously served as MP for Gomoa East Constituency from 2017 to 2021. He lost his re-election bid to Desmond De-Graft Paitoo in 2020, cited unfinished projects, including roads, water, electricity, and school infrastructures, stalled since his tenure ended in 2020. Asemanyi criticized the current MP for inaction, saying the constituency lacks development and pledged to address these challenges and facilitate growth in the area.
The “Kojo Oku 4 Kojo” a three days program offered, Free medical screening, Street light installation, Church visits, Free NHIS registration, Subsidized birth certificates, Stakeholder engagement and Asemanyi Football Cup.
